#01ee78 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01ee78 is composed of 0.4% red, 93.3%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.6%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 150.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 46.9%. #01ee78 color hex could be obtained by blending #02fff0 with #00dd00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

#01ee78 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01ee78 has RGB values of R:1, G:238, B:120 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 126584.
